Pelicans Injury Report Vs Kings

Pelicans Can Clinch Playoff Berth with Win Over Kings

New Orleans Holds 2-Game Lead with Three to Play

Key Matchup on Thursday Night in Golden 1 Center

The New Orleans Pelicans and Sacramento Kings will face off on Thursday night in a crucial Western Conference matchup. The Pelicans currently hold a two-game lead over the Kings for the eighth and final playoff spot in the West, with just three games remaining in the regular season.

The Pelicans are coming off a 120-112 win over the Golden State Warriors on Tuesday night, while the Kings lost 118-113 to the Los Angeles Clippers. The Kings are 1-2 against the Pelicans this season, with the Pelicans winning the first two meetings in New Orleans and the Kings winning the most recent meeting in Sacramento on March 28.

The Pelicans are led by Brandon Ingram, who is averaging 24.5 points per game this season. Zion Williamson is also a key player for the Pelicans, but he is currently sidelined with a foot injury. The Kings are led by De'Aaron Fox, who is averaging 25.2 points per game this season. Domantas Sabonis is also a key player for the Kings, but he is currently sidelined with a thumb injury.

The game will be played at Golden 1 Center in Sacramento, California. Tip-off is scheduled for 10:00 PM EST.
